Take a Deep Breath
7 17 25 HFL
July 17, 2025

Let everything that has breath praise the Lord!

Psalm 150:6

“Take a deep breath in through your nose and out through your mouth,” the pulmonary therapist tells her patient. For those who are aged or altitude challenged, that action may be difficult. This exercise reminds us that God has given us breath and provides it daily. From the first cry of a newborn to the final sigh of a dying person, God has given life and breath to His children.

We tend to take breath for granted, as well as many other things. There are parts of the body that we can do without, but breath is not one of them. Today we give thanks to God for the air in our lungs which allows parts of our bodies to work together to sustain us. Take a deep breath and give thanks to God for His amazing creation!

Margaret Hinchey
Loveland, CO

Creator God, we give You thanks for the gift of our breath which gives us daily life. Amen.

Reflect: Take a few moments to inhale and exhale. With each breath, thank God for someone in your life.

Read: Genesis 2:5-7 and Psalm 104:27-33
